OHL will build a new office building in Madrid with a proposal budget of 35 million

April 23, 2021

OHL has been awarded the construction of a new office building in Madrid, in the Las Tablas neighborhood, located in the Fuencarral-El Pardo district. The project has a proposal budget of 35 million euro and will be executed on a plot of more than 8,700 square meters. The building opts for LEED® Platinum and WELL Platinum sustainable construction certifications, specializing in the health and well-being of people.

The building features, among its main characteristics, a glass enclosure with clear and opaque parts in the slab passage. Its north-south orientation will optimize the energy efficiency and interior lighting of the spaces.

It should be noted that, in the field of construction, OHL has outstanding experience in the construction and rehabilitation of buildings in which it incorporates energy sustainability criteria certified by the most exacting international standards. This includes LEED® certificates (Leadership in Energy & Environmental Design), granted by the US Green Building Council; BREEAM®, which recognizes the optimization of natural resources and the construction materials used; Passivhaus, which promotes the optimization of the energy generated, and the Sustainable Building Certification (SBC), which allows the inclusion of passive energy saving strategies. In addition, in the field of health and well-being of people, the WELL certification will be sought, considered the first in the world focused exclusively on the health and well-being of people.

The projects carried out by the company include the rehabilitation of the Castellana 81 building (Madrid, Spain) and the Sunset Office Center (Miami, USA), both LEED® Platinum. In addition, the Castellana 81 building is certified as WELL Gold, a Core & Shell typology, becoming the first building in Spain and one of the first five in Europe to achieve this distinction.

Also, Torrespacio, a skyscraper built by OHL in Madrid, in the well-known Cuatro Torres Business Area and which houses the headquarters of OHL in Spain, holds BREEAM® certification for excellent use; and the new building of internal medicine and geriatrics of the Olomouc hospital (Czech Republic) is Passivhaus certified. For its part, the future Curicó Hospital (Chile) opts for SBC certification.
